Sounds like you're in for a terrific time. I would, however check and see about the mini-suite receiving the perks you mentioned. Maybe the Gem is different, but mini-suites do not usally get priority embarkation & dinner reservations. It's usally AE & higher. I hope I'am wrong and you do get these perks, but I hate to have you go on your cruise and you don't get them. Please check again--if it was a TA she/he might be mistaken. If I'am wrong I want to know as don't want to pass on any false info.

I have a question about the comments you made re: the minisuite. It is more realistic to think of the minisuite as a being a "deluxe balcony" rather than a suite. So, I was wondering.. who told you what about the benefits you will receive by being in a minisuite?

 

You will indeed have some limited priority for restaurant reservations (48 hours in advance vs. 24 hours for inside and oceanview cabins). But ..."embarkation etc etc."?? Please expand on this as perhaps you have discovered some hidden or new benefits available to minisuite guests.
